BIOGRAPHY

An artist, curator, theoretician, and the creator of the Michal Heiman Tests (M.H.Ts). She has exhibited in Israel, The United States, Australia, Japan, France, Germany, Holland and more. Her work is included in the collections of major museums in Israel and abroad. A lecturer at the Bezalel Academy of Art and Design in Jerusalem, Tel Aviv University Faculty of Arts and the Sackler Faculty of Medicine, Program of Psychotherapy. Heiman was announced as the recipient of the first Shpilman International Prize for Excellence in Photography. Young Artist Prize, America-Israel Cultural Foundation. 1994 Na’amat Prize for Women who Made History in the Field of Art. Artist-in-Residence, the McGeorge Fellowship at The University of Melbourne, Australia. 1996 Minister of Education and Culture Prize for Artists in the Field of Visual Art. 2003 Encouragement Prize, Ministry of Education and Culture. 2004 Enrique Kavlin Photography Prize, The Israel Museum, Jerusalem.
